HLFX.Ru Forum
Показать все 13 сообщений этой темы на одной странице

HLFX.Ru Forum (https://hlfx.ru/forum/index.php)
- Half-Life SDK (https://hlfx.ru/forum/forumdisplay.php?forumid=8)
-- Half-Life1 Ragdoll или физика тел (https://hlfx.ru/forum/showthread.php?threadid=5633)


Отправлено Next Day 24-03-2021 в 09:45:

Half-Life1 Ragdoll или физика тел

Всем привет лазил по интернету и наткнулся на это чудо по этому адресу
https://www.moddb.com/mods/half-life1-ragdoll-lib
Лично у меня скомпилировать добавит не получилось ,но здесь есть опытные кодеры которые наверняка разберутся как это сделать.
А может и даже как это добавить в XASH
Блин это сильно оживит Goldsrc и XASH


Отправлено Дядя Миша 24-03-2021 в 11:21:

GoldsrcPhysics is a physics engine written in csharp
Еще и буллет.

В ксаш-моде уже есть физика, надо лишь рагдолл прикрутить. За 8 лет так никто и не сподобился.

Добавлено 24-03-2021 в 14:21:

PS. Он бы хоть демку рабочую выложил напосмотреть что ли.

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'


Отправлено Aynekko 24-03-2021 в 11:56:

На видео классно выглядит, вот бы в ксаш такое.

__________________
Мой мод на Xash


Отправлено ncuxonaT 24-03-2021 в 11:57:

Цитата:
Дядя Миша писал:
В ксаш-моде уже есть физика, надо лишь рагдолл прикрутить.

Это которая на физиксе что ли?


Отправлено Дядя Миша 24-03-2021 в 12:19:

Она, да.

Добавлено 24-03-2021 в 15:19:

Цитата:
Aynekko писал:
На видео классно выглядит, вот бы в ксаш такое.

а после сейврестора что происходит?

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'


Отправлено Aynekko 24-03-2021 в 12:32:

Это знает только создатель)

__________________
Мой мод на Xash


Отправлено Дядя Миша 24-03-2021 в 14:39:

Ну я же и говорю, выложил бы рабочую демку напосмотреть.
Там же какие-то конфигурационные файлы с описанием рагдоллов должны быть еще.

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'


Отправлено Ku2zoff 25-03-2021 в 02:51:

Цитата:
Дядя Миша писал:
GoldsrcPhysics is a physics engine written in csharp
Еще и буллет.

А што хорошего в сишарпе, интересно?
Цитата:
Aynekko писал:
На видео классно выглядит, вот бы в ксаш такое.

Партикли, показывающие, что зомбак застрял в браше, это классно?
Цитата:
Дядя Миша писал:
а после сейврестора что происходит?

Эффект вроде бы чисто клиентский. Значит, серверная модель либо остаётся стоять, либо по-обычному умирает.

Ох уж эти китайцы. Партия им дала открытые сорцы клиентки, а они пишут непонятную внешнюю либу.

Добавлено 25-03-2021 в 09:29:

Цитата:
Дядя Миша писал:
Ну я же и говорю, выложил бы рабочую демку напосмотреть.
Там же какие-то конфигурационные файлы с описанием рагдоллов должны быть еще.

На гитхабе есть краткая инструкция о том, как интегрировать либу в свой мод, полные сорцы на сишарпе и скомпиленная дллка. Как писать конфиг-файлы тоже есть. Ещё есть сорцы, где все API-функции вписаны в клиентку, надо только скомпилить.

Добавлено 25-03-2021 в 09:51:

Ууу, мерзость какая. Нужен .NET Framework 4 SDK, чтобы скомпилить клиентку-пример. Ну это уж совсем. Вот вам и сишарп. То есть, не только BulletSharp.dll тащит за собой дотнет, но ещё и клиентка не заведётся без него. По-хорошему, нету дотнета - не грузится либа - нет физики. А тут даже клиентка инициализироваться не будет. Это называется современный подход к написанию софта. Неудивительно, что новые проги и игры разжирели до невероятных размеров, потребляют кучу ресурсов и крашатся на каждый чих.


Отправлено XaeroX 25-03-2021 в 03:50:

Цитата:
Ku2zoff писал:
нету дотнета - не грузится либа - нет физики

По-моему, это прекрасно - физика, не работающая без дотнета.
Это то, о чём так долго говорили большевики.

__________________

xaerox on Vivino


Отправлено Aynekko 25-03-2021 в 05:32:

Цитата:
Ku2zoff писал:
Партикли, показывающие, что зомбак застрял в браше, это классно?

Я имел в виду физику тел, а партикли это результат неправильной расстановки монстров в хаммере - задевает браш. На это вообще побоку. Вроде это и так ясно было.

__________________
Мой мод на Xash


Отправлено Дядя Миша 25-03-2021 в 07:30:

Цитата:
Ku2zoff писал:
и скомпиленная дллка

я не нашёл

Цитата:
Ku2zoff писал:
Нужен .NET Framework 4 SDK, чтобы скомпилить клиентку-пример.

ну как заведёшь - выложи мод

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'


Отправлено Crystallize 25-03-2021 в 07:39:

На ютубе есть ещё какой-то Daniel Paul Schreber со своим Pathos Engine/DavisEngine, недавно смотрел его видео где он запилил в хл мотоцикл от 1 лица и катался на нем по буткемпу. Но сейчас он скрыл свои видео. Всё что осталось https://www.worldnews.easybranches....rs-bike/8867286


Отправлено Ku2zoff 25-03-2021 в 13:22:

Цитата:
Дядя Миша писал:
я не нашёл

Сама либа - BulletSharp.dll. Клиентку, естественно, кетаец не приложил.
Цитата:
Дядя Миша писал:
ну как заведёшь - выложи мод

Не, мне жалко места на ЦЭ под дотнет сдк. И так всего 19 гб из 55 свободно, и здоровье у ссд 71 процент. Хочу, чтобы диск ещё пару лет пожил. Китаец сам соберёт по реквестам на моддб. У него изначально даже аглицкой документации не было, только на китайском. Народ в ханьцзы ни бе ни ме, ни одного ероглифа не понимает, вот и затребовали у него перевести на интернациональный демократический.


Временная зона GMT. Текущее время 13:41.
Показать все 13 сообщений этой темы на одной странице

На основе vBulletin версии 2.3.0
Авторское право © Jelsoft Enterprises Limited 2000 - 2002.
Дизайн и программирование: Crystice Softworks © 2005 - 2024